Climbing Section (per person)
Helmet. Approved climbing helmet.
Harness.
3 locking carabiners. (auto or screw lock)
3 tethers.
Rappell device. (ATC or figure 8)
Prussic
Jumars - one pair with correct length tethers and foot loops.
Gloves
(Note: A total of at least 3 tethers is required. If you re-rig between ascents and descents, 3 tethers will work, If you prefer not to have to re-rig between ascents and descents then you will need at least 4 tethers and possibly 5. )

Prohibited Equipment.
Phone, excepting the phone sealed by Gold Rush.
Communication devices excepting the radio sealed by Gold Rush.
Maps other than those provided by Gold Rush. Including use of such maps at ACP’s . Crews may have road maps available but teams may not refer to them.
Sails or Kites during the paddling sections.
GPS devices including wrist styles. Trackstick or similar devices that cannot be read in the field are OK.
Minimum Medical kit:
- sunscreen.
- lip balm with sun protection. SPF 15 minimum.
- Electrolyte replacement tabs ( at least 4 per team member each day)
Analgesic tablets (at least 2 per team member per day) - Antihistamine tablets (2 per team member)
- Sterile 3' x 3" or 4" x 4" dressing (4 minimum)
- Blister dressing (enough to supply 2 teammates each day, explain how you plan to use it)
- Needle
- Tweezers
- Scissors or blade
Additional Suggested Medical Kit Items.
Antacid tablets
Decongestant tablets
Foot powder/lubricants for blister PREVENTION
PeptoBismol or Imodium (antidiarrheals)
Disinfectant (Purell or alcohol wipes).
Antibiotic ointment (Polysporin/double antibiotic)
Safety pin
Duct tape .
Crazy glue or similar
Ace wrap
Minimum Bike Tool kit:
multi-tool with phillips and flat head screw drivers, allen wrench set
two tire levers
pump
one inner tube per team member
inner tube patch kit, 4 patches
Suggested Bike Tool Kit.
chain repair tool
chain repair link (one for each type of chain on team's bikes)
extra rear derailer or "singulator"
more extra inner tubes
extra bike tires
spare chain
spare cables
spare seat (especially if yours is super light)
Note: Make sure your brakes are in top condition prior to the start of the race.
